Anxiety is a complex mechanism that is triggered to help us deal with many of our day to day activities. Therefore anxiety is a normal reaction to stressful situations that people experience. However anxiety can become overwhelming and dominating, that is the exact point when it becomes what medics call 'chronic anxiety'.

There are many methods and techniques that can help you overcome anxiety, such as medication which may be recommended to you by your psychiatrist in order to help you reduce your symptoms. Several other techniques may include therapy, relaxation techniques, acupuncture, light therapy etc.

With million of Americans suffering from one anxiety disorder or another, this mental illness is considered one of the most predominate and costly in the country. An estimated $22.8 billion is spent on anxiety-related problems each year. Understanding why these disorders are so debilitating starts with taking a closer look at anxiety symptoms.
